About This School

Cape Fear Community College is a public institution located in Wilmington, North Carolina with approximately 9,497 undergraduate students enrolled. The average net price after financial aid is $5,416 per year. Typical graduates earn $31,600 within 10 years of enrollment.

Cape Fear Community College (CFCC) is a public community college in Wilmington, North Carolina. It enrolls nearly 23,000 students each year. The service area of Cape Fear Community College includes New Hanover and Pender counties with a main campus located in downtown Wilmington and satellite campuses in Castle Hayne, Burgaw, and Surf City.

At just $5,416/year after aid and a median graduation debt of only $6,334, this is one of the most affordable college options you'll find — a genuine strength for cost-conscious students in the Wilmington area. The concern worth naming is the median earnings figure of $31,600 ten years out, which is modest, so your outcome will depend heavily on which program you choose — healthcare, trades, and technical programs here tend to lead to better-paying jobs than general studies paths.
